I have problem to send mail from my PC (Windows 10) I got message back saying "Can't verify certificate because it has expired"

It also said "  period of validity: Started  June 16 2017    Ended  June 16 2020

I am using Thunderbird version 60.6.1 I have tried to upgrade to Thunderbird 68 but it does not help. But when I do this I got lost of all my mail and all saved mails in maps. Also the whole adresslist is gone away.

How can I get a new certificate ?? Best regards / Lasse Kullberg e-mail

Hello, i have at last succeedid to fill in the parameter for the servers and now it works again also with AVG Here are my figures sending server: smpt.bredband.net port 465 with SSL/TLS authentication = no Incommingn server: pop.glocalnet.net port 110 No SSL/TLS authentication = password

And now it works from three PCs with different Windows verison. One with AVG. Something must have happened june 16 when all PCs and my mobile were unable to send e-mail. The message expired certificaton has no meaning. Ican get this error message by changing a parameter.
